nginx lua post 路由
access_log/home/logs/nginx/mallaccess.logmain; error_log /home/logs/nginx/mallerror.log debug;sendfile on;
keepalive_timeout65;
server {
listen 80;
server_namemapi.wanlitong.com;
include /usr/local/openresty/nginx/conf/lua/*.conf;
root /data;
location ~* /mobileapi/m2s/pointsmall/queryProdInfo.do {
error_page 404 @errorjump;
}
location @errorjump {
rewrite_by_lua '
ngx.req.read_body()
local a = ngx.req.get_post_args()["goodsId"]
local b = ngx.req.get_post_args()["repositoryId"]
function Sleep(n)
os.execute("sleep " .. n)
end
ngx.redirect("http://mapi.wanlitong.com/"..a..b..".json")
';
}
}
页:
[1]